How To Sharpen A Chainsaw Blade?

Wear gloves and safety glasses

Secure the chainsaw with the chain brake engaged

Clean the chain and inspect for damage

Identify the correct file size for your chain

Use a round file and file guide

Match the file angle to the cutter angle

File each cutter from the inside to the outside

Use smooth, even strokes

Count strokes and keep them consistent on each cutter

Sharpen all cutters on one side first

Rotate the saw and sharpen the cutters on the other side

Keep all cutters the same length

Check and adjust depth gauges with a flat file and gauge tool

Lubricate the chain after sharpening

Test the chain tension before use

Run the saw briefly and recheck performance
